Win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Rock Hill). Their defense stepped up to hand the Princeton Panthers a 7-0 shutout on Tuesday. The victory continues a trend for the Blue Hawks in their matchups with the Panthers: they've now won six in a row.
Rock Hill's win bumped their record up to 6-8. As for Princeton, they dropped their record down to 0-11 with the defeat, which was their sixth straight at home.
Rock Hill wasted no time getting back out on the pitch and has already played their next game, a 4-3 loss against Plano West on the 21st. As for Princeton, they also didn't take long to hit the pitch again: they've already played their next match, an 8-0 defeat against Plano on the 21st.
